Transaction 5139320e2cfbfbd84f1aa90e46136fae251ade7fa38ca5a9f5c7856d7e8a6212

1 Input
2 Outputs
  • 5139320e2cfbfbd84f1aa90e46136fae251ade7fa38ca5a9f5c7856d7e8a6212:0
  • value  2150469
    address  3ECzEVPaAdqdKye6WdfqkoDEytBC3FYTc8
  • 5139320e2cfbfbd84f1aa90e46136fae251ade7fa38ca5a9f5c7856d7e8a6212:1
  • value  1789566
    address  14dZ1JbtCdA6F2UB6WFTm4kaLptC3kGhwD